How does federalism affect the freedom of speech?

A negative aspect of federalism regarding freedom of speech is the fact that there have been restrictions placed on freedom of speech by the government that bring the question of whether or not it is a violation of our basic constitutional rights and whether or not there is actually true freedom of speech.

What does the First Amendment say about free speech?

According to the first amendment “Congress shall make no law respecting an establishment of religion, or prohibiting the free exercise thereof; or abridging the freedom of speech, or of the press; or the right of the people peaceably to assemble, and to petition the Government for a redress of grievances.” (Constitution,1789).

Why is freedom of speech important to a democracy?

“Freedom of Speech is a basic right that many consider fundamental to the continued health and well-being of democracy” (Campbell, 2017 p.249). Democracy is a positive quality of federalism. Democracy is what makes us different from most of the world.

Is there a limit to freedom of speech?

Freedom of speech is not totally free, as seen in federalism, civil liberties, and civil rights, there is always a stipulation or limit to what we can say and when we can say it. American Civil Liberties Union. (2016). Freedom of Expression.
